On October 21, 2019, Canadians across the country will go to the polls to vote for the candidates they believe will best serve the interests of Canada and her people.
But do you know who you will vote for? Do you know which candidates best represent your views?
On Thursday, October 3, the Archdiocese of Toronto will be hosting "Federal Election Debate from a Catholic Perspective," a chance for candidates to express themselves on topics important to Catholics and an opportunity for Catholics to ensure we get the information we need.
The debate will take place at 7:30 pm ET on Thursday, October 3 at the John Bassett Theatre in the Metro Toronto Convention Centre and will be moderated by award winning journalist Don Newman.
